Home staging is all about impact, speed, and efficiency. The goal is clear: sell properties faster, achieve higher prices, and create an emotional connection with potential buyers.

But there’s one area where many projects fall short: the kitchen.

While living rooms and bedrooms can be styled relatively easily, the kitchen presents a much bigger challenge. Many rely on traditional kitchen solutions — and that’s exactly where the problem begins.


The Problem: Traditional Kitchens Aren’t Built for Home Staging

Traditional kitchens are designed for permanent installation. Home staging, however, requires flexibility, mobility, and speed.

This creates a clear mismatch.

Typical challenges include:

  • ❌ High upfront costs
  • ❌ Time-consuming planning and installation
  • ❌ Long delivery times
  • ❌ Limited flexibility for different layouts
  • ❌ Complex logistics and transport

For temporary use in home staging, these drawbacks quickly become deal-breakers.


Time Is Money — Especially in Real Estate

The longer a property stays on the market, the greater the risk of price reductions and lost buyer interest.

A traditional kitchen often means:

  • Weeks of planning
  • Delivery times stretching over several weeks
  • Installation by professionals

➡️ This simply doesn’t fit the fast pace of home staging.


Cost vs. Value: A Poor Investment

Installing a full kitchen is expensive — but in home staging, it rarely delivers long-term value.

Why?

  • The kitchen typically remains in the property
  • It cannot be reused for future projects
  • The return on investment is limited

In many cases, you’re investing heavily in a solution that’s used only once.


Lack of Flexibility Is a Major Limitation

Every property is different.

Traditional kitchens:

  • are designed for a single layout
  • are difficult to adapt
  • require significant effort to modify

➡️ This makes them impractical for home stagers and real estate professionals working across multiple properties.

Why the Kitchen Is So Important

The kitchen is one of the most emotionally impactful spaces in a property.

If it’s missing or unattractive:

  • perceived value drops
  • buyers struggle to imagine living there
  • sales cycles become longer

A well-staged kitchen, on the other hand:

  • creates atmosphere
  • increases perceived value
  • accelerates the sale
